Happy Hour at Wegmans

Local supermarket chain expands its playing field with full-scale restaurant and bar

Wegmans shoppers will be spending even more time at the supermarket than before.

The Pub at Wegmans is the supermarket’s newest addition to its ever-growing dining scene at the in-store Market-Café.

The full-scale restaurant and bar are open at the Wegmans in Collegeville, Pa., Malvern, Pa. and King of Prussia, Pa.

The Pub offers American cuisine made by their executive chefs, a variety of craft beers by Pennsylvania breweries, a selection of wines from all over the world, and a list of original, but exciting cocktails.

“The Pub is a great option for so many diners -- shoppers who prefer not to ‘shop hungry,’ people who live nearby and want a quick meal on the way home from work, even families who want to enjoy an affordable dinner without all the cooking and cleaning,” says Kathy Haines, director of Wegmans in-store restaurants and Market-Cafes. 

The traditional grocery store is a thing of the past for one of the country’s leading supermarket chains.

“It’s all part of our ongoing mission to offer our guests the best and most comprehensive food experience, from shopping for groceries to enjoying dinner and drinks,” said Haines in a press release. “A simple grocery store isn’t enough anymore; our customers asked for fresh meals to go and dine-in options, and we listened.”
